Radiotherapy Plus GnRH Analogue Versus High Dose Bicalutamide: A Case Control Study

Summary
Adjuvant hormone therapy (HT) combined with radiotherapy (RT) improves prostate cancer (PC) outcomes. Bicalutamide offers similar survival rates to gonadotrophin-releasing hormone agonists (GnRHa) in PC patients receiving RT.

Background:
- Radiotherapy (RT) combined with adjuvant hormone therapy (HT) enhances prognosis for prostate cancer (PC) patients.
- Gonadotrophin-releasing hormone agonists (GnRHa), also known as luteinizing hormone-releasing hormone (LH-RH) analogues, represent the standard HT.
- High-dose antiandrogen therapy demonstrates survival benefits in locally advanced PC.
Purpose of the Study:
- To compare the efficacy of RT plus GnRHa versus RT plus bicalutamide in PC patients.
- To evaluate biochemical relapse-free survival in patients receiving different adjuvant HT regimens.
Main Methods:
- Retrospective review of 318 PC patients from an institutional database.
- Inclusion criteria: patients treated with definitive or postoperative RT +/- HT.
- Median follow-up duration of 56 months.
Main Results:
- Five-year biochemical relapse-free survival rates were comparable: 85.5% for GnRHa and 88.3% for bicalutamide (p=0.712).
- No statistically significant difference in relapse-free survival between the two treatment groups.
Conclusions:
- Bicalutamide can be considered an alternative adjuvant treatment to RT for PC patients who cannot tolerate GnRHa due to side effects.
- The findings support the need for randomized clinical trials to directly compare RT plus GnRHa and RT plus bicalutamide.
